What is a lead generation process? It is the process of attracting and retaining potential customers and converting them into buyers. This process revolves around enticing the users to buy products or services that your business has to offer.

Why is lead generation important? The motto of any business activity narrows down to generating profit. The business growth depends on the sales, which further depends on generating good quality leads.

All businesses want more leads. But without a proper lead generation strategy, businesses are bound to feel lost and will not be able to achieve their lead goals. Therefore, it is important to have a lead generation marketing strategy in place.

Clear CTA

The action you want your users or visitors to take should be mentioned clearly on your website. If you want them to purchase a book, let them know! If you want them to subscribe to a newsletter for digital marketing tips, let them know. Whatever it is that you want them to do should be mentioned in your Calls-to-Action.

When a user lands on your website or landing page, they should know exactly where to go and what to click on. Your CTA should guide your users on what to do next. The easier you make it for your users to find a CTA on your website, the higher chances you have of getting a lead.

A/B testing

As a business owner, how do you ensure that your marketing strategy is in place and does not need any change? Many of you would suggest Google analytics. And we agree with that! Google analytics is an integral part of any activities you carry out online. It lets you analyze the traffic on your website and gives you a good idea of what works and what doesn’t.

Apart from Google Analytics, consider A/B testing. AB Testing ensures that the marketing campaigns you run are optimal and effective. A/B testing will allow you to make minor tweaks to the same campaign and test which one is more effective. You can do this till you arrive at the most optimal or successful campaign.

Micro influencers

Micro influencers are lesser known influencers that have influence in a smaller niche. For small businesses who want to influence a specific niche, must consider hiring micro influencers.

Promotion by micro influencers is bound to attract the attention of their followers. So, when micro influencers start promoting your business, all eyes would be on you, creating a huge scope for generating leads.
